Uses of divinylbenzene

Divinylbenzene has two vinyl groups, is highly reactive and can generate insoluble polymers with a three-dimensional structure. It is an important crosslinking agent. Widely used in the manufacture of ion exchange resins, unsaturated polyester resins, ABS resins, polystyrene resins and modified styrene butadiene rubbers, and also used for copolymerization of styrene, butadiene, acrylonitrile, methyl methacrylate, etc. and acrylic acid Crosslinker for ester emulsion polymerization. Generally, the crosslinking speed of p-divinylbenzene is faster, and the higher the content of the parasite, the better the performance of the resin obtained. In addition, it is also used in wood processing and in the manufacture of flame retardants.
